MARLIN WEEKLY DEMOCRAT
Thursday, April 6, 1989
Marlin, Falls County, Texas
MRS. MARY CHANE GAMEZ
Mrs. Mary Chane Gamez, 75, of Marlin, died Saturday in a
local hospital.
Funeral services were at 2 p.m. Monday at the Adams Funeral Chapel, Elder
L. L. Spicer officiated. Burial was in Calvary Cemetery.
Mrs. Gamez was born March 4, 1914 in Falls County, the daughter of Arthur Chane
and Alice Hueitt Chane.
She married Trinidad Gamez Sept. 15, 1928 in Temple. The couple had
resided in Corpus Christi for many years. They moved to Marlin in 1972.
Mrs. Gamez was a member of the Assembly of God Church.
Survivors include her husband of Marlin; a son, A. W. (Bull) Gamez of Corpus
Christi; two daughters, Mrs. Lois G. DeLeon and Mrs. Mary A. Barrow, both of
Marlin; four brothers, George Chane of Weatherford, Thomas Chane of Bellmead
and Robert Chane and Jessie Chane, both of Marlin, three sisters, Mrs. Jo Britt
and Mrs. Rosie Brunson, both of Marlin; and Mrs. Willie Mae Stachowiak of
Houston; nine grandchildren; and 12 great-grandchildren.
Grandsons were pallbearers.
